💬 Nutrition Q&A: The Laughing Cow, Blue Cheese Wedges

Is The Laughing Cow, Blue Cheese Wedges good for weight loss?

These wedges are quite low in calories at about 35 per piece, making them a reasonable option for weight loss when portion-controlled. The 3g of protein per wedge helps with satiety, though pairing them with vegetables or whole grains would create a more filling snack.

Is The Laughing Cow, Blue Cheese Wedges a good snack for kids?

Kids generally enjoy these mild, creamy cheese wedges, though the blue cheese flavor might be an acquired taste for younger palates. The small wedge size makes them convenient for lunchboxes.

Is The Laughing Cow, Blue Cheese Wedges suitable for people with lactose intolerance?

Unfortunately, these are not suitable for people with lactose intolerance, as they're made from cow's milk and contain whey and nonfat milk solids.

What diets does The Laughing Cow, Blue Cheese Wedges suit?

They work well for keto and low-carb diets given the minimal carbohydrates and reasonable fat content. Vegetarians can enjoy them, though they're not suitable for vegans.

What does The Laughing Cow, Blue Cheese Wedges pair well with for a balanced meal?

Pair these with whole grain crackers, fresh vegetables like apple slices or celery, or cured meats for a simple charcuterie snack. They also work nicely alongside a piece of fruit to balance the sodium content.
